Historical Background and Evolution
The concept of cookies dates back to 1994, when Lou Montulli invented them as a way to maintain state in stateless HTTP protocols. What began as a simple mechanism for e-commerce carts quickly morphed into a surveillance tool, as advertisers realized cookies could track users across sites. Chrome, launched in 2008, inherited this duality: cookies as a necessity for web functionality and as a liability for privacy. Early versions of Chrome offered rudimentary cookie management, but the ability to delete individual cookies in Chrome remained buried in developer tools—a nod to the browser’s origins as a tool for web builders, not end-users.
Over time, privacy scandals and regulatory pressures forced browsers to evolve. Chrome’s 2018 introduction of "Site Settings" and later, the "Privacy Sandbox," signaled a shift toward balancing tracking with user control. Yet, the granular cookie deletion feature remained unchanged, reflecting a reluctance to overhaul a system that, while imperfect, serves both developers and advertisers. Today, the method to selectively remove Chrome cookies is still tucked away in developer tools, a relic of Chrome’s utilitarian design philosophy.
Core Mechanisms: How It Works
At its core, Chrome’s cookie storage is a key-value database tied to each website’s domain. When you visit a site, Chrome stores cookies in a structured format that includes the domain, path, name, value, and expiration date. Developer tools provide a read-write interface to this database, allowing users to inspect, modify, or delete individual entries. The process involves opening Chrome’s DevTools (F12 or Ctrl+Shift+I), navigating to the "Application" tab, and locating the "Storage" > "Cookies" section. Here, you’ll see a list of all cookies for the current domain, complete with their metadata.
The actual deletion happens via a context menu—right-clicking a cookie and selecting "Delete." This triggers Chrome’s underlying storage engine to remove the entry from its SQLite database, which syncs across all tabs and sessions. The mechanism is efficient but requires precision: deleting the wrong cookie (e.g., an auth token) can log you out of a site. Comparative Analysis
| Method | Pros | Cons |
|---|---|---|
| Developer Tools (Application > Cookies) | Native, no extensions, full control over individual cookies. | Requires technical familiarity; no visual domain filtering. |
| Extensions (e.g., Cookie-Editor) | User-friendly interfaces, domain-wide filters, bulk actions. | Potential privacy risks; relies on third-party code. |
| Chrome Settings (Clear Browsing Data) | Quick and simple for bulk deletion. | No granularity; wipes all cookies for selected time ranges. |
| Incognito Mode | Session cookies auto-delete when the window closes. | Not persistent; doesn’t address stored cookies from normal sessions. |

Q: Can I delete individual cookies in Chrome without using developer tools?
A: Not natively. Chrome’s Settings menu only allows bulk deletion by time range (e.g., "Last hour," "All time"). For granular control, you must use the Application > Cookies panel in DevTools or a trusted extension like Cookie-Editor. Third-party tools may offer more user-friendly interfaces but come with their own risks.
Q: Will deleting a cookie log me out of a website?
A: It depends on the cookie’s purpose. Session cookies (often named like `sessionid` or `auth_token`) are critical for authentication. Deleting them will force you to re-log in. Persistent cookies (e.g., `user_preferences`) may not affect logins but could reset customizations. Always check the cookie’s name and domain in DevTools before deletion.
Q: How do I find the exact cookie I want to delete?
A: In Chrome’s DevTools (F12 > Application > Cookies), filter the list by domain (e.g., `google.com`) or use the search bar (Ctrl+F). Look for suspicious names like `__gads` (Google Ads), `user_id` (tracking), or `session` (auth). For third-party cookies, check the "Domain" column—if it’s not the site you’re visiting, it’s likely a tracker.
Q: Does deleting cookies in one Chrome profile affect others?
A: No. Chrome profiles store cookies independently. Deleting a cookie in one profile won’t impact another. This is useful for testing or maintaining separate digital identities (e.g., work vs. personal). To switch profiles, click your profile icon in the top-right corner of Chrome.

Q: Why does Chrome’s cookie list show different entries than what I deleted?
A: Cookies can regenerate if the website re-sets them (e.g., after page reloads or via JavaScript). Some cookies are dynamically created (e.g., CSRF tokens). To permanently remove a cookie, delete it after logging out or closing the site’s tab. For stubborn trackers, use Chrome’s "Site Settings" to block third-party cookies entirely.
